Output 58ba610b376ac358e914c7bbd58df09748c2efe73993d1831b534378b6bd9690:0

value
56786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902cb9d831ee030d630bc87d6abb72e7fd88a126 OP_EQUAL
address
3EqLonG8YtBFjC2qgavAxDF7gpzhZgC8sc
transaction
58ba610b376ac358e914c7bbd58df09748c2efe73993d1831b534378b6bd9690
confirmations
428991
spent
true